Ingredients
– 2 salmon fillets (about 6 ounces each)
– 2 cups broccoli florets
– 1 cup teriyaki sauce (store-bought or homemade)
– 2 tablespoons sesame oil
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
– 1 tablespoon brown sugar (optional, for additional sweetness)
– Cooked rice or quinoa (for serving)
– Sesame seeds (for garnish)
– Green onions, sliced (for garnish)
Instructions
1. Prepare the Teriyaki Sauce: In a small saucepan, combine the teriyaki sauce, minced garlic, grated ginger, and brown sugar (if using). Heat over medium heat until the mixture starts to simmer, then reduce the heat and let it c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until slightly thickened. Remove from heat and set aside.
2. Cook the Broccoli: In a separate pot, bring water to a boil and add the broccoli florets. Blanch for about 2-3 minutes until they are bright green and tender-crisp. Drain and set aside.
3. Prepare the Salmon: Season the salmon fillets with salt and pepper on both sides. In a large skillet, heat the sesame oil over medium-high heat. Once hot, place the salmon fillets skin-side down in the skillet.
4. Sear the Salmon: Cook the salmon for about 4-5 minutes, then carefully flip and cook for another 3-4 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ork.
5. Combine Ingredients: Once the salmon is cooked, pour the teriyaki sauce over the fillets and add the blanched broccoli. Gently toss to coat the broccoli and salmon in the sauce.
6. Serve: Serve the Savory Teriyaki Delight over cooked rice or quinoa, and garnish with sesame seeds and sliced green onions.
Understanding Teriyaki Sauce
Teriyaki sauce has its roots in Japanese cuisine and is traditionally used to glaze meats and vegetables, imparting a sweet and savory flavor. The primary ingredients in teriyaki sauce include soy sauce, brown sugar, rice vinegar, sesame oil, garlic, and ginger. Each component contributes to a balanced sauce that enhances dishes without overpowering them.
Health-wise, teriyaki sauce can be made with lower sodium options, which is beneficial for those monitoring their salt intake. Additionally, garlic and ginger offer antioxidant properties, promoting overall wellness.
Ingredient Spotlight
The star ingredients in this dish are salmon and broccoli. Salmon is renowned for its high content of omega-3 fatty acids, which are essential for heart health, as well as being a great source of protein and various vitamins. Broccoli, on the other hand, is rich in fiber, vitamins C and K, and contains numerous antioxidants which support a healthy immune system.
Using fresh ingredients is crucial for maximizing both flavor and nutritional benefits. Fresh salmon will have a firm texture and a vibrant color, while fresh broccoli should be bright green and crisp.

Cooking the Salmon
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
1. Preparation: Start by patting the salmon fillets dry with paper towels. This step is essential for achieving a nice sear, especially if you are pan-frying.
2. Seasoning: Lightly season both sides of the salmon with salt and pepper.
3. Cooking Temperature: Preheat your grill or skillet to medium-high heat (around 375°F to 400°F).
4. Cooking Time:
– For grilling: Cook salmon for about 4-5 minutes on each side, depending on the thickness of the fillet.
– For pan-frying: Cook for approximately 3-4 minutes per side.
5. Applying Teriyaki Sauce: Brush teriyaki sauce on the salmon during the last minute of cooking. This allows the sauce to caramelize slightly, enhancing the flavor without burning.
Techniques for Applying Teriyaki Sauce
To maximize the flavor of the teriyaki sauce, consider marinating the salmon for 30 minutes before cooking. This will ensure that the fish absorbs the marinade’s flavors. Additionally, reserve some sauce to drizzle over the finished dish for an extra burst of taste.
Steaming the Broccoli
Best Practices for Steaming Broccoli
Steaming broccoli is an excellent way to retain its vibrant color and nutrients. For optimal results, follow these steps:
1. Preparation: Cut the broccoli into bite-sized florets.
2. Steaming: Use a steamer basket over boiling water, cover, and steam for about 3-5 minutes, until the broccoli is bright green and tender yet crisp.
3. Seasoning: After steaming, toss the broccoli with a pinch of salt, a squeeze of lemon juice, and a drizzle of sesame oil to enhance its flavor.

Discussion of Dietary Adaptations
For those with dietary restrictions, consider using gluten-free soy sauce for the teriyaki sauce to maintain a gluten-free dish. Alternatively, vegetarians can replace salmon with tofu, marinating and cooking it in the same manner to absorb the teriyaki flavors.
